sql >> Databáze >  >> RDS >> Mysql

Nemohu najít chybu v mém php skriptu

Dotaz jste nespustili pomocí mysql_query() a nenastavíte proměnnou $curPageURL .

<!DOCTYPE html>
<html>
 <body>

 <?php
 function curPageURL() {
 $pageURL = 'http';
 if ($_SERVER["HTTPS"] == "on") {$pageURL .= "s";}
 $pageURL .= "://";
 if ($_SERVER["SERVER_PORT"] != "80") {
  $pageURL .= $_SERVER["SERVER_NAME"].":".$_SERVER["SERVER_PORT"].$_SERVER["REQUEST_URI"];
 } else {
  $pageURL .= $_SERVER["SERVER_NAME"].$_SERVER["REQUEST_URI"];
 }
 return $pageURL;
 }
 echo curPageURL();

 //connection
 $con= mysql_connect("localhost","root","") or die ("Could not connect");
 mysql_select_db("search") or die ("Could not select db");
 echo "connection succesful";

 $query = "SELECT id FROM search WHERE link = '". curPageURL() . "'";
 $result = mysql_query($query);

 while($row = mysql_fetch_array($result)) {
 echo $row;
 }
 ?>

 </body>
 </html>

Vezměte prosím na vědomí, že metoda, kterou jste použili, je zastaralá z php 5.5.0. takže doporučuji zvážit mysqli nebo PDO. příklady lze nalézt v níže uvedených odkazech na manuál php

http://www.php.net/manual/en/mysqli.query .php

http://www.php.net/manual/en/pdo.query .php



  1. Problém s vytvořením Postgres RDS v Cloudformation Template

  2. Dotaz MySQL pro výběr dat z minulého týdne?

  3. Pomalý dotaz s levým vnějším spojením a podmínkou null

  4. Změňte oddělovač na čárku při odesílání výsledků dotazu e-mailem na SQL Server (T-SQL)